Chapter 8: Visiting to Marry
In a blink of an eye, it was the 15th day of the eighth month. The moon was full and bright, like a pearl hanging in the sky. The moonlight was truly as beautiful as water.
The Mid-Autumn Festival was also the last birthday that Xiaoyue from the Shen family spent at home.
The family had dinner early and the yard was decorated with red silk, double happiness patterns and colorful flowers hanging everywhere. The refreshments for tomorrow's guests were also arranged. Everything was in order and very festive.
The father of the Shen family was still worried, so he took his son to check over and over again, including the dowry, tables and chairs, brocade stools, wine, fruit plates, firecrackers...
In Chen Qi's room, Zhang was crying to her daughter.
"I've raised my daughter for eighteen years, and now she's become someone else's daughter-in-law. How can I not be sad?"
Her sister-in-law patted her back gently to comfort her.
"Mother, that's not the case. Even if I become someone else's daughter-in-law, I will always be your daughter. Even if we are at the ends of the earth, it won't change. Besides, Pingshan County is not far away. Look at the tall and majestic horses of the Xie family. If we harness them to the carriage, we can be back in an hour."
"That's right. From now on, when I eat breakfast and go out, I can still have lunch made by my mother."
Chen Qi snuggled in her mother's arms, deliberately acting coquettishly to make her mother laugh.
After hearing this, Zhang tapped Chen Qi's forehead with her finger, and she really felt a little relieved. She then pulled her daughter aside and said a lot of things, and Chen Qi agreed to all of them.
They talked until they were exhausted. Zhang asked her daughter-in-law to go and settle down first. After the people left, she quietly took out a roll of drawing paper wrapped in red cloth from the bottom of her box.
"Mom, what is this?"
Shen Qi was curious, having never seen this before.
"Silly boy, take a good look at this tonight. Tomorrow night, you'll know what husband and wife are all about."
This sentence made it clear that Chen Qi immediately realized what this thing was, and her face turned red.
Having grown up, she vaguely knew that there were some things between men and women that could not be told to outsiders, but she couldn't say what they were.
After Zhang left, Chen Qi closed the door, got into bed, and looked carefully in the light of the lamp.
Although the album has been around for a long time and the edges of the paper have turned yellow and the lines are a little blurry, the details on the paintings are still very clear.
Chen Qi stared for a long while, her heart beating loudly. She felt scared at one moment and a little expectant at another. She tossed and turned until she fell into a light sleep at three o'clock in the morning.
Before going to bed, I naturally looked at it carefully again, and then solemnly put it back in its place, pretending that nothing had happened.
At daybreak, Chen Qi was already dressed. Zhang and Qiao had already come over and gave her instructions one by one.
"Once the veil is put on, it cannot be taken off. When we get to the bridal chamber, the groom can only take it off after everyone is present."
"It's a long journey, and the sedan chair is bound to be bumpy. Just sit still inside and don't move. If you have anything to say, tell Matchmaker Xue quietly. She's been following us all the way."
"The Xie family's residence is on Yinshi Street in Pingshan County. That street is the busiest, and there must be many people coming to see the bridal sedan today. Don't be nervous."
"His family is not like ours. They are originally a wealthy family in the county. If there are any differences between them and ours, just look at how the girls and sisters-in-law in their family act and learn from them."
"If the son-in-law is not a good person, don't make trouble at his house first, and tell me when you come back in three days."
Chen Qi found it a little funny after hearing this. She was already eighteen years old. Did she still need her mother to teach her about such things?
But she looked at her mother's serious expression and nodded quickly.
I didn't sleep well last night because of the little picture book, and I woke up early today. I was too sleepy, but I felt more energetic.
Xie Yuduo was riding a tall horse with snow-white fur today, wearing a carefully tailored red wedding dress, a red silk embroidered on his body, and a red silk tied around his waist, which made him look even more broad-shouldered and narrow-waisted. His eyebrows were as sharp as swords, and his eyes were bright.
The groom walked at the front of the procession with a smile on his face and his head held high, attracting the attention of many onlookers along the way.
The custom here is that the bride and groom must start worshiping heaven and earth before noon, because Pingshan County is thirty miles away from here, and the sedan chair cannot be as fast as a carriage. There will be music and music along the way, and it will take about an hour and a half to get there. It also needs to leave enough time for the groom to greet the bride at the bride's house, block the door, and pay respects to his parents.
For this reason, just after breakfast time, the Xie family's team came over with music and drums.
Along the way, people stopped to watch and talk about it.
"What a remarkable young man! He outshines even the eldest son of the Shen family! When the new son-in-law comes, he won't be the most handsome man in Baihe Town anymore!"
"From behind, they look about the same, but from the front, the groom is more handsome."
"That's what they call, if you're not from the same family, you won't enter the same door, hahaha."
"Look at our Xiaoyue'er's appearance and figure. If he wasn't such a talented person, how could he be worthy of her!"
Although everyone was just a neighbor watching the fun, they consciously considered themselves to be part of Chen Qi's family.
When the sedan chair arrived at the door of the Shen family, the sound of firecrackers popped continuously.
The sister-in-law hurriedly helped Chen Qi cover herself with a red veil embroidered with mandarin ducks and decorated with colorful beads, and carefully told her that she must not lift it up under any circumstances before entering the bridal chamber.
Chen Qi had already been dizzy from her mother's endless stream of instructions about what not to do and what not to do, so now she just nodded and sat obediently on the bed.
There are a set of rules for the groom to dismount, enter the house, pass through the courtyard, and block the door, which has always been the highlight of weddings.
When she was little, Chen Qi loved watching the groom come in to pick up the bride. Now it was her turn. Her mother and sister-in-law went out to entertain the guests, and everyone went out to see the groom. For a moment, she was the only one left in the room.
The voices were getting closer, and I guess they were blocking the door.
Once inside, the bride will follow the groom.
Chen Qi listened to the sounds of firecrackers, talking, and suona outside. Louder than these sounds was the sound of her own heartbeat.
With a bang, the door was pushed open by the crowd, and the noise became noisy.
"Here comes the groom!"
"Here, here, push slower!"
"Where is the bride?"
There were many people watching the fun, and the young people who came with the Xie family were afraid that they couldn't squeeze in, so they desperately threw out handfuls of copper coins.
Seeing the yellow new copper coins scattered all over the yard, all the neighbors rushed to grab the copper coins, but the groom found the opportunity, took a step with his long legs, stepped over the crowd, and successfully entered the house.
Following the groom, matchmaker Xue also squeezed in.
Perhaps because she had seen many situations and was experienced, she was even quicker than the groom.
He walked to the window in two steps, stuffed a red satin embroidered ball into Chen Qi's arms, and handed the other side to Xie Yuduo who was striding towards him, and then announced loudly to the crowd -
"The auspicious time has arrived, and the bride is leaving!"
After paying farewell to Shen's parents, matchmaker Xue helped the bride into the bridal sedan, and Xie Yuduo rode on the white horse. The wedding procession started playing music and marched slowly out of the street among the crowd.
Seeing her daughter wearing a bright red wedding dress, getting into a bright red sedan chair, and leaving home in the blink of an eye, Zhang cried so hard that her eyes were blurred with tears.
Father Shen looked at his wife crying and patted her shoulder to comfort her.
"He's back in just two days. What's there to be afraid of? Seeing how my son-in-law protected Xiaoyue all the way when he went out, he's a good candidate for a good ending..."
Having said that, there was also sadness in his eyes.
Only after the sedan chair disappeared did the old couple reluctantly return home.
Matchmaker Xue was indeed experienced. The wedding procession played music and danced all the way, and arrived at the gate of the Xie family just before noon.
